Presentation Transcript


  1. Launching Microsoft Smart Watch in Hong Kong

  2. The Product Concept • The watches, often referred to as SPOT wristwatches, are based on Microsoft's "Smart Personal Objects Technology" (SPOT). • They are meant to be both fashionable and functional.

  3. The Product Concept • www.msndirect.com

  4. The Product Concept • The Very Smart Watch • Smart Watches for MSN Direct combine technology and style to deliver personalized information with just a glance at wrist. • MSN Direct teamed with leading watch manufacturers to design watches that are as fun as they are informative!

The Product Concept • Personal channels on the watch • The information you receive on your watch is organized by channel. • Similar to the channels on your television set, you see different types of information—such as news and weather—when you switch channels on your watch. • You can customize the information that you see for each channel.

The Product Concept • Activating MSN Direct service. • Just a few quick steps and you can immediately start enjoying the benefits of MSN Direct! • Your Smart Watch for MSN Direct comes ready to receive national news, weather and a monthly calendar. • If you upgrade your MSN Direct subscription, you can choose from additional channels, like sports scores, stock quotes and more!

The associated technology - Smart Personal Objects Technology (SPOT) • At the heart – the watches use wireless technology and FM frequencies to: • Provide a variety of information in “near real-time”. • The information could include news headlines, sports scores, movie information, stock quotes, weather forecasts, as well as traffic reports, personal messages, and appointment reminders.

The promises of the product concept • Commented by Cindy Spodek Dickey, Microsoft's group marketing manager for SPOT. • "Smart Watches with MSN Direct are a fun new way for people to get the information they care about delivered to an accessory they wear everyday," • "Being part of this high-energy fashion show is a great venue to illustrate how technology and lifestyle products can merge in exciting and innovative ways. But, how to best position and promote the product remains a marketing challenage"

Motives for the strategic move • One of Microsoft’s efforts to go “beyond the PC” • An extension of the DataLink wristwatch, developed in conjunction with Timex – “noble failure”. • The progression of computing platforms over time – from mainframes to PCs to PDAs to celluar phones…to PocketPCs…and next to “enhance devices that consumer already used in their everyday lives.”

Pricing the product and its associated service • Since the watches are fed data through an FM subcarrier that transmits weather, traffic, and other information over low-power FM frequencies, a subscription to MSN Direct is required. • Watch owners can choose between two subscription plans: $9.95 a month with the first month at no charge; or $59 for a full year.
